Output 518ad69f8ef523f57ba68d8eb9e61f74580b6052ccdba94d32df5ade23ba115b:0

value
52581138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3ac83029ce8b8ef132b4eeefb5bacb25d3cb6d OP_EQUAL
address
3QmyJKZJSigyN5fNTJTwkQp6JnzXMKyQNB
transaction
518ad69f8ef523f57ba68d8eb9e61f74580b6052ccdba94d32df5ade23ba115b
confirmations
299561
spent
true